C-Evo: Civilization, we all know that game created by Sid Meier. It is highly popular and new versions of that game make are produced regulary. C-Evo tried to correct errors and design mistakes from the original Civilization game reducing luck for instance (winning with a lancer against a tank is highly unrealistic, don´t you think ?). If you like Civilization you will like C-Evo.

LGeneral: I enjoyed the first Panzer General game, played it for hours and hours. The main reason for that was that there have not been that many turn-based games in the time when Panzer General was released. It featured complete World War II campaigns and you had the chance to change the course of history. Conquer the United States with Germany ? No problem, just play very very good and you might make it. LGeneral is a faithful copy of the original Panzer General game.

Neverball: Neverball reminds me of the C-64 classics Trailblazer and Marble Madness. Collect as many coins with the ball as you can. Movement is a quite unique experience though. You do not control the ball directly but raise or lower the sides of the complete playfield. Great experience.

Settlers 3D: Settlers of Catan is a great boardgame that was created in Germany. The goal of the game is to reach a certain amound of points by gathering ressources, trading them with other players and building towns and roads. Settlers 3D is an open source implementation of that boardgame including the popular seafarers addon.

WinLems: Lemmings was a huge success for DMA design back on the good old Amiga. It was ported to PC, console systems and handhelds and is most likely one of the most ported games of all time. A bunch of lemmings fall out of a generator and you have to guide them to the level exit by giving some of them various functions like blocking and digging.
